2023 Bronco Model Year Transition​

Anyone who has been through a model year conversion for Bronco knows the information can be confusing, especially considering the number of series and options available and the way those have affected pricing protection in the past. For 2023, Ford is streamlining the program.

Private Offer program
The first change is doing away with the term “Price Protection.” Now, dollar amounts offsetting the MSRP increase from time of reservation/order date to the current MSRP will be called a private offer –– officially: 2023 Bronco Model Year Transition Private Offer.

Next is a two-step process to determine your private offer amount. Last year, several dates and situations factored into price protection. This year, Ford is focusing on March 19, 2021 and September 9, 2022:

  • Did you order prior to March 19, 2021?
  • What was your series and door count prior to September 9, 2022?

Private Offer Amounts​

These amounts apply to all 23MY Broncos except Bronco Raptor and Heritage Limited. The amounts are based on customer order/reservation date, series selected, and order changes.

How To Use the Table:
Step 1
– Do you get a Level A or Level B Offer?

  • Level A: Reservation / Order placed on or before March 19th, 2021
  • Level B: Order placed on or after March 20th, 2021

Step 2 – What was your order series / door configuration?

  • Private Offer amounts are based on the Series / Door Configuration ordered prior to the model year changeover (September 9th, 2022).
  • Changes to orders on or after September 9, 2022 will not impact Bronco Private Offer amounts.

Frequently Asked Questions​

Q: Is Bronco Raptor covered under 2023 Bronco Model Year Transition Private Offer?
  • No, the Bronco Raptor is a specialty vehicle and not covered under Bronco Private Offer.

Q: Do unconverted reservations still receive the 2023 Bronco Model Year Transition Private Offer?
  • Yes, unconverted reservations still receive a 2023 Bronco Model Year Transition Private Offer. All unconverted reservations need to be converted into an order by November 21, 2022 or they will be canceled. The 2023 Bronco Model Year Transition Private Offer amount will be determined by the customers level in the chart above.

Q: How do I know when the original Reservation/Order was placed?
  • To find original Reservation details, dealers can use www.emp.dealerconnection.com. For order details dealers should refer to WBDO. Customers can find their reservation and order dates in their reservation and order confirmation emails or their Ford.com account.

Q: How will 2023 Bronco Model Year Transition Private Offer be given and claimed in 2023?
  • If a customer is eligible for an offer from a reservation or order that originated as a 2021 or 2022 model year, private offers will be generated on the impacted customers’ behalf and be visible to Dealers upon running a SmartVINCENT Certificate Inquiry. The offer can then be applied towards the deal to reduce the total customer cost of the vehicle.

Q: What types of changes can be made to an order now without impacting Private Offer amount?
  • Private Offer amounts are based off what was reserved or ordered prior to the model year change over. Changes to orders after September 9, 2022 will not impact 2023 Bronco Model Year Transition Private Offer amounts.

From the FAQs:
If I change my order to an Everglades or Heritage Edition (not including Heritage Limited Edition), do I still qualify for price protection?
Yes. By switching to a Heritage Edition (excluding Heritage Limited Edition), you still qualify for price protection. New in 2023 MY, you will also qualify for price protection by switching to an Everglades. The amount varies depending on the series you previously ordered. Please work with your dealer to determine the amount you qualify for.

Ford told dealers all customer certificates are preloaded into SmartVINCENT, and that dealers should use the Certificate Inquiry screen to verify customer eligibility and Private Offer value under Program #38644.
